Information Technology facilities at the School include:
- Multiple computer labs plus additional desktop and laptop computers for student and staff use
- Latest hardware with flat-panel monitors, CDRW and DVD drives
- Access to relevant programs & CD-ROMs for all subject areas
- High-speed monochrome and colour laser printers
- Many data projectors used for in-classroom instruction and presentations
- The School Intranet, providing access to key learning resources
- Specialised software, equipment and PCs for Art, Music, Drama, and Science students
- Dedicated mini-labs for Art, Music, Drama and D&T/Tech Drawing students
- A professional-grade high-speed network covering the entire School campus
- One of the State's fastest connections to the internet
- A wireless network for laptop computers
How are students using technology at North Sydney Boys' High School?
- Conducting research combining use of the internet, journals and the School's Library
- Composing music using computers connected to music keyboards
- Building their own websites
- Collecting scientific data using computer-connected monitoring equipment
- Creating documents and exchanging e-mails with their teacher in Japanese
- Using computer-aided drawing (CAD) programs to model projects for Design & Technology
- Writing software programs using Visual Studio for Software Design & Development
- Using Photoshop and other programs to create stunning artworks
